Significant differences between beefsteak raw and cardamom

  • Beefsteak raw has more vitamin B12, vitamin B3, and vitamin B6; however, cardamom is richer in iron, fiber, magnesium, calcium, copper, and vitamin C.
  • Cardamom covers your daily iron needs 150% more than beefsteak raw.
  • Cardamom contains less cholesterol.

Specific food types used in this comparison are Beef, loin, top sirloin cap steak, boneless, separable lean only, trimmed to 1/8" fat, all grades, raw and Spices, cardamom.
